yyloveyxq 发表于 2025-3-20 00:05:30

关于反斜杠的问题

图片数据 = 读入文件 ("D:\MyGame\FYengine\build\bin\Release" + "\s.png", )
这样无法读取我的图片数据

图片数据 = 读入文件 ("D:\\MyGame\\FYengine\\build\\bin\\Release" + "\s.png", )
这样就能成功读取。。

但使用子程序后 把"D:\\MyGame\\FYengine\\build\\bin\\Release" + "\s.png"做为变量 传入子程序后在读取又无法读取了。

调试输出变成了D:\MyGame\FYengine uild in\Release\s.png


中间的\b 就被自动删除了!

这是什么原因? 难道我文本常量或者字符串   它转义符 也要管?

dengzf 发表于 2025-3-20 02:02:55

\b 是退格符,,,,,,,,,,需要再转议下

edu 发表于 2025-3-20 04:33:11

文本型的变量编辑器会自动帮你转义吧,你的\\会变成\\\\来着?

乐易论坛 发表于 2025-3-20 07:52:36

火山的\需要转义 ctrl+shift+v

yyloveyxq 发表于 2025-3-20 22:26:09

谢谢 我在试试
页: [1]
查看完整版本: 关于反斜杠的问题